graphql查询方案优化起因graphql API对外提供完整的接口文档,按需取数据的功能,对于接口联调和前端开发同学看来绝对是神器,但对于初看graphql的后台同学看来,这个取数据怎么取?对于一个两层结构的列表数据,我对列表中的每一项都取一次二级数据?这后台抗得住吗?举个例子:我们有这样一个应用场景,我们要取一个用户列表,列表中每一项展示有3个字段id、name、friends,friend
转载 9月前
27阅读
一、入门GraphQL是一种用于API的查询语言,是基于类型系统来进行查询的。一个GraphQL服务是通过定义类型和类型上的字段来创建的,然后给每个类型的每个字段提供解析函数。定义类型示例:type Query { me: User } type User { id: ID name: String }  定义解析函数示例:function Query_me(request) {
转载 2024-02-26 10:34:41
386阅读
原文地址:How to Implement a GraphQL API on Top of an Existing REST API原文作者:Tyler Hawkins译者:samyu2000校对者:PassionPenguin, k8scat 你的 dad jokes 放在哪儿?当然是在 dadabase 里。我们来想象一下,你是全世界最受欢迎的 dad jokes 数据库的管理员。项目的技术
阅读本文的知识前提:熟悉 TypeScript + GraphQL + Node.js + Decorator + Dependency Inject 等概念。 前言 恰逢最近需要编写一个简单的后端 Node.js 应用, 由于是全新的小应用,没有历史包袱  ,所以趁着这次机会换了一种全新的开发模式: 语言使用 TypeScript,
As we start building out more complex GraphQL schemas, certain fields start to repeat across different types. This is a perfect use-case for the Inter
转载 2017-01-10 22:19:00
253阅读
2评论
Schema创建一个schemaGraphQL API具有一个Schema,该Schema定义了可以Query(查询)或Mutation(变更)的每个字段以及这些字段的类型。graphql-java提供了两种不同的定义schema的方式:编程方式编写,和使用graphql dsl语法(也称为SDL)编写。例如:SDL示例:type Foo { bar: String }Ja
If we have a GraphQL Schema expressed in terms of JavaScript, then we have a convenient package available to us that let’s us easily serve up our sche
转载 2016-12-29 15:53:00
201阅读
2评论
# 如何在 MySQL 中查询所有 Schema 在数据库管理中,Schema 是一个非常重要的概念,它是数据库对象的集合,帮我们有组织地管理数据库中的表、视图、存储过程等。对于刚入行的开发者,了解如何查询 MySQL 中的所有 Schema 是一种基本技能。今天我将带你一起来了解这个过程,下面是我们要遵循的步骤。 ## 查询流程概述 以下是查询 MySQL 所有 Schema 的步骤:
原创 11月前
155阅读
 1.1 MapInfo简介MapInfo是美国MapInfo公司的桌面地理信息系统软件,是一种数据可视化、信息地图化的桌面解决方案。它依据地图及其应用的概念、采用办公自动化的操作、集成多种数据库数据、融合计算机地图方法、使用地理数据库技术、加入了地理信息系统分析功能,形成了极具实用价值的、可以为各行各业所用的大众化小型软件系统。MapInfo 含义是“Mapping + Informa
作者: 高斯Influx官方博客。背景GaussDB(for Influx)是一款基于华为自研的计算存储分离架构,兼容InfluxDB生态的云原生NoSQL时序数据库,提供一站式时序数据存储,分析,展示功能。其中时序洞察提供了针对时序数据的可视化功能。在监控领域,我们经常见到绚丽的监控大屏,实时反映整个系统运行情况,就是监控看板功能。通过监控看板,可以高效的运用监控数据辅助定位故障、性能调优、容量
Dmidecode-查询硬件信息内容1. 前言2. 实作环境3. 安装及设定1. 步骤1.安装 dmidecode 套件2. 步骤2.开始使用 dmidecode3. 补充1:硬件信息号码及关键词4. 补充2:硬件 序号/版本/制造商 关键词4. 参考前言[dmidecode] 为一套可轻松显示您目前主机的各项硬件信息套件,它查询在您主机 BIOS 当中 SMBIOS/DMI 信息查达到查询各项硬
模块 npm install -g get-graphql-schema get-graphql-schema GRAPHQL_URL > schema.graphql 简单使用 使用prisma cli prisma init appdemo cd appdmeo docker-compose u
原创 2021-07-18 14:56:03
650阅读
使用的是apollo 的插件 安装apollo npm install -g apollo 基本使用 因为我使用了模式拼接,所以地址有变动,一般是 http://host:port/v1alpha1/graphql 格式 apollo schema:download --endpoint=http:
原创 2021-07-19 15:35:07
200阅读
GraphQL 模式是任何 GraphQL 服务器实现的核心。它描述了连接到它的客户端应用程序可用的功能。我们可以...
原创 2024-02-10 16:12:00
78阅读
常用pgsql-- 列出所有schemaselect * from information_schema.schemata; -- Schema所有表 select * from pg_tables where schemaname = 'query_db' and tablename in('port','device','res_carry_business','hardware','she
·In the last article, we discussed the ins and outs of remote (executable) schemas. These remote schemas are the foundation for a set of tools a
转载 2021-07-18 14:56:28
223阅读
1、入门GraphQL是一种新的API标准可以替代REST.它是一种声明式的数据获取方式,让客户端可以从服务器端获取精确地所需的数据。和传统的提供多个端口,每个端口提供固定的数据不同,GraphQL只提供一个端口处理客户端所有的请求。GraphQL是一种api查询语言,而不是数据库。在任何需要使用API的地方都可以使用GraphQLGraphQL比REST更加的高效。因为它定义了架构shcema
graphql-compose 是一个强大的graphql schema 生成工具集 包含以下特性 快速便捷的复杂类型生成 类型仓库,类型可以存储在schemacomposer 存储中 包含flowtype(不太还用),typescript 的类型定义 方便的插件 包含json 以及date 类型
原创 2021-07-19 10:48:53
343阅读
# 查询所有schema的SQL Server流程 本文将指导你如何使用SQL Server查询所有schema。对于刚入行的开发者来说,了解如何查询schema是非常重要的,因为schema是数据库中组织和管理数据的基本单位。下面是整个流程的概览: ```mermaid journey title 查询所有schema的流程 section 连接到数据库 secti
原创 2023-09-01 05:25:41
1135阅读
# 如何使用MySQL查询所有Schema MySQL是一款广泛使用的开源关系数据库管理系统。在开发过程中,我们常常需要查询数据库中的所有Schema(即数据库集合)。今天就来分享一下如何在MySQL中实现这一目标。以下将从流程入手,并详细讲解每一步的代码及其注释。 ## 流程概述 实现“查询所有Schema”的整个过程可以分为以下几个步骤: | 步骤 | 描述
原创 11月前
675阅读
  • 1
  • 2
  • 3
  • 4
  • 5